Transaction 17255475812a690b1053d8f8cb7886149282a87a80e7b6b9ed1fed2070cd6585
1 Input
1 Output
-
17255475812a690b1053d8f8cb7886149282a87a80e7b6b9ed1fed2070cd6585:0
- value
- 2970680
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f18daecac262efe5e90a463667e85f18f5fa60b1 OP_EQUAL
- address
- 3PiEW4r2nvpaqbDRSFrGfYr5Gjgn2xUS4S